“Barbie” star trans actress Hari Nef is reported to star in an upcoming biopic for the trans legend Candy Darling.
The film will follow Darling’s childhood in Long Island through her years along with other underground superstars such as Holly Woodlawn and Jackie Curtis in Andy Warhol’s Factory scene. The Factory was Warhol’s studio in New York City, which was famous for its parties in the 1960s.
It will also delve into her influence on several great musicians like Lou Reed and Patti Smith. Darling was also immortalized in the Rolling Stones’ song “Citadel” and is the inspiration for the song “Candy Says” by the Velvet Underground. She was also one of the subjects of Reed’s “Walk on the Wild Side.”
